Output 0d3c34c631c424a4d6152098e71b33d8ccf2ceb635aab53048d5416f1058bd0e:0

value
589543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bc505fcc949fa47c507b03cfc38c81cf4c8cc5e OP_EQUAL
address
MARzW2xkfwmWBiHxakiiBC45vD7Kd76REo
transaction
0d3c34c631c424a4d6152098e71b33d8ccf2ceb635aab53048d5416f1058bd0e
spent
true